The University of Sheffield is seeking to recruit to the role of Associate Director of EFM: Engineering & Maintenance. The University of Sheffield is a truly special place, with a bold and ambitious future. A leading global university renowned for the excellence, impact and the distinctiveness of its research-led learning and teaching across a wide range of disciplines, we are home to 30,000 of the brightest students and over 8,000 staff from more than 140 countries around the world. We want Sheffield to be an international centre of excellence for centuries to come, so we recruit ambitious, creative people from across the globe and we nurture their talent.
The Department of Estates and Facilities Management (EFM) at the University of Sheffield is the largest Professional Services Department at the university, employing over 720 staff across a range of professions and specialist areas. Now is an exciting time to take up a leadership role within the department. Following the appointment of a new Director of Estates and Facilities Management in March 2024, EFM is entering a transformational period with further leadership appointments in the department that will shape the team and culture for many years to come. There are exciting challenges ahead, with the development of a new estate strategy, significant capital investment, drive to net zero, asset management and space optimization, engineering and maintenance delivery, and campus services provision.
We are seeking an individual with significant career experience in engineering leadership roles across large-scale, operational property portfolios, together with a track record of planning and executing transformation programs resulting in performance improvement in the areas of engineering, maintenance, and estate compliance.
